Flex4数据交互开发详解

5星 · 超过95%的资源 需积分: 10 24 下载量 140 浏览量 更新于2024-07-28 收藏 3.22MB PDF 举报
"Flex4中文教程是一份详细讲解Flex4如何与服务器端进行数据交互的开发教程,适合希望深入理解Flex4技术的开发者学习。该教程由Adobe Systems Incorporated创作,适用于2010年的Flex4预发布版本。教程涵盖了Flex4在实际应用中的核心概念、技术和实践方法,旨在帮助读者掌握利用Flex4构建富互联网应用程序(RIA)的能力,特别是与后端服务器的数据通信技术。" Flex4是Adobe Flex框架的一个重要版本,它提供了许多新特性和改进,以增强开发者创建交互式和动态Web应用程序的能力。Flex4引入了全新的Spark组件模型,相比于之前的MX组件,Spark组件更加灵活,允许开发者自定义和扩展UI组件。此外,Flex4还强化了皮肤和样式系统,使得界面设计更加个性化和专业化。 在数据交互方面,Flex4支持多种数据访问技术,如HTTPService、WebService、AMF(Action Message Format)等,这些技术使得Flex应用程序能够与各种后端服务器(如Java、PHP、.NET等)进行无缝通信。通过使用这些服务,开发者可以轻松地发送和接收数据,实现CRUD(创建、读取、更新、删除)操作。Flex4还集成了 Cairngorm、PureMVC等流行的企业级框架,以支持更复杂的应用程序架构和数据管理。 此外,Flex4还增强了ActionScript 3.0的支持,ActionScript是Flex应用程序的主要编程语言。ActionScript 3.0具有类型系统和面向对象的特性,提升了代码的性能和可维护性。同时,Flex Builder(后来称为Flash Builder)作为IDE,为开发者提供了强大的代码编辑、调试和测试工具,极大地提高了开发效率。 教程可能包括以下内容:基础概念介绍、Flex SDK和Flex Builder的安装与配置、Flex组件库的使用、ActionScript编程基础、数据服务的配置与使用、事件处理机制、动画和效果的实现,以及如何进行性能优化和测试。 Flex4中文教程对于想要深入理解和掌握Flex技术,尤其是与服务器端数据交互的开发者来说,是一份宝贵的参考资料。通过学习这个教程,开发者将能够运用Flex4构建功能丰富的、与后端数据紧密集成的RIA应用程序。